I am an NSF-funded postdoctoral researcher at UW–Madison (Hite Lab), where I study how evolutionary and ecological processes shape disease dynamics across space and time.
Before that, I did my Ph.D. in Finland studying the ecology and evolution (more on the inclusive fitness side of things) of poison frog tadpoles.
Pretty riveting stuff.
I have also studied monkeys in Morocco, other frogs in other places, and even worked at a tea shop before being fired for my poor customer service.
